P-TECH PENNSYLVANIA PROGRAM VIRTUAL INFO SESSIONS OFFERED 

EVERETT, Pa. (Apr. 30, 2021) – Allegany College of Maryland will host virtual information sessions at 2:00 p.m. and 7:00 p.m. on May 13 for rising area high school juniors and seniors interested in the college’s P-TECH Pennsylvania program. Preregistration for the info sessions is required and available at allegany.edu/ptechpa.

P-TECH Pennsylvania offers qualified eleventh and twelfth graders the chance to take technology courses at their own pace, or enroll in a two-year, 31-credit certificate in Cybersecurity through the ACM Bedford County Campus. Classes, video conferences and labs are offered online. Funding through a donation by Everett Cash Mutual Insurance Co. (ECM Insurance Group) covers the cost of tuition, registration fees, and textbooks for the 2021-2022 academic year. 

P-TECH Pennsylvania’s Cybersecurity certificate program prepares students for a career in cybersecurity, information assurance or network security and administration. Courses include, among others, Business Administration, Computer Literacy, Digital Forensics, Cyber Law, Operating Systems and Cisco Networking. Upon certificate completion, students will be prepared to sit for their Cisco and CompTIA industry certification exams. Students are encouraged to continue their studies at ACM after graduating from high school. Courses offered through the program can be applied towards an associate of applied science degree in Computer Technology – Area of Concentration in Cybersecurity or a different area of concentration within ACM’s Computer Technology program.
